My wife and I were on our honeymoon and stayed at the Leeson Guesthouse just down the road. The Canal Bank Cafe has a truly delicious Full Irish Breakfast and a great assortment of other casual dining options. For about 14 Euro there's sausage, bacon, eggs, black and white pudding, and the most incredible butter/sautee mushrooms you can ever get. Service was friendly and the place accepts American credit card, for any fellow Yanks that choose to stop in. I hadn't thought to read about tipping customs in Ireland and ended up providing a lavish tip mistakenly. No regrets, great food.
